What separates a top performer from a good performer is a clear, repeatable approach to the paper \u2014 one that turns knowledge into points under pressure. This guide walks you through a calm, practical, step-by-step plan for attempting the full paper in a way that maximizes accuracy, minimizes unnecessary risk, and helps you convert preparation into a high percentile.<\/p>\n<p><img src='https:\/\/asset.sparkl.me\/pb\/blogs-image\/img\/658271248408450d996b58e81c1d1961.jpg' alt='Photo Idea : A focused student at a desk with a laptop showing a timed mock test interface, pen and timer visible'><\/p>\n<h2>Start with the Right Mindset<\/h2>\n<p>High percentiles are earned by consistent accuracy and smart selection, not frantic attempts. Treat the exam as a sequence of choices: which question to pick, when to move on, and when to invest time. Two foundations matter more than anything: precision (avoid careless loss of marks) and tempo control (don\u2019t spend disproportionate time on low-return problems).<\/p>\n<h3>Understand the Exam Context<\/h3>\n<ul>\n<li>JEE Main is an objective-style exam delivered in a fixed-duration sittings \u2014 practicing full 3-hour mocks is non-negotiable.<\/li>\n<li>There is negative marking for incorrect attempts \u2014 plan your guesses and eliminations carefully.<\/li>\n<li>Though the test is computer-based, maintain OMR-like discipline: mark carefully, avoid last-minute frantic toggling, and use flags\/review markers methodically.<\/li>\n<li>Syllabus alignment matters: Physics, Chemistry, and Mathematics are the pillars. Focus on concepts that are frequently tested and build speed on standard question types.<\/li>\n<li>There is no partial credit for incomplete or descriptive answers \u2014 clarity in final answer selection is everything.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2>Before the Exam: Preparation That Sets Up the Attempt<\/h2>\n<h3>Practice Like the Test<\/h3>\n<p>Do timed, full-length mocks under exam conditions \u2014 three hours, uninterrupted. In each mock you should practice the same behaviors you will on the real day: quick scanning, disciplined skipping, and strict time caps per question. Repetition builds not just skill but the pattern-recognition system you&#8217;ll rely on under pressure.<\/p>\n<h3>Build a Mistake Journal<\/h3>\n<p>After every mock or test, record three things for each mistake: the root cause (concept gap, calculation error, silly mistake), how to fix it, and a short practice task to prevent recurrence. Over weeks this journal becomes a surgical repair kit for your weaker areas.<\/p>\n<h3>Sharpen Short Bursts<\/h3>\n<p>Work 30\u201360 minute focused sessions where you target one topic deeply (e.g., definite integrals, thermodynamics, or electrostatics). These \u201cmicro-sessions\u201d improve mental endurance for complex multi-step questions.<\/p>\n<h2>During the Exam: The Three-Pass Strategy<\/h2>\n<p>When the clock starts, follow a three-pass method designed to protect accuracy while maximizing score.<\/p>\n<h3>Pass 1 \u2014 Quick Harvest (First 30\u201345 minutes)<\/h3>\n<p>Goal: Secure all low-hanging fruits. In the first pass you will skim the entire paper quickly and solve every question that you can answer in under 1.5\u20132 minutes with high confidence. These are the questions you know without doubt. Don\u2019t get lured into long, unfamiliar problems.<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Mark answers confidently and flag anything you changed your mind on.<\/li>\n<li>Skip any question that looks like it will take more than ~2 minutes at this stage.<\/li>\n<li>Maintain a steady pace: this pass is about clean, efficient scoring.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3>Pass 2 \u2014 Targeted Work (Middle 70\u201390 minutes)<\/h3>\n<p>Goal: Work on the medium-difficulty questions you skipped earlier. These often require a short derivation, a quick calculation, or an application of a standard trick. Use this pass to add high-probability marks while still guarding accuracy.<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Set a firm time limit for each problem (3\u20138 minutes depending on complexity).<\/li>\n<li>If a problem is taking longer than its time cap, mark it for Pass 3 and move on.<\/li>\n<li>Use elimination methods to convert medium-difficulty MCQs into high-probability picks.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3>Pass 3 \u2014 Deep Dives and Review (Final 35\u201365 minutes)<\/h3>\n<p>Goal: Tackle the difficult problems selectively, revisit flagged answers, and do a focused review. This stage is high-value if you have energy and clear strategy: pick the tough problems you are reasonably prepared for, not the ones that are brand-new or require lengthy derivations.<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Reserve the last 7\u201310 minutes for a final sweep: check units, sign errors, digit transposition in numeric answers, and any inadvertently unflagged choices.<\/li>\n<li>Trust the earlier decisions \u2014 avoid changing answers on impulse unless you have clear reason.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2>Decision Rules: When to Guess and When to Leave<\/h2>\n<p>Negative marking means blind guessing carries risk. Use eliminations and probability reasoning rather than gut feelings. A simple practical rule: if you can eliminate one or more options and bring your probability of being correct significantly above chance, guessing becomes justified. If you truly have no idea and time is better spent elsewhere, skip it.<\/p>\n<div class=\"table-responsive\"><table>\n<thead>\n<tr>\n<th>Eliminations<\/th>\n<th>Estimated Probability<\/th>\n<th>Practical Decision<\/th>\n<\/tr>\n<\/thead>\n<tbody>\n<tr>\n<td>0 options<\/td>\n<td>~25%<\/td>\n<td>Consider skipping unless you have time and low opportunity cost<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>1 option<\/td>\n<td>~33%<\/td>\n<td>Guessing improves expected gain; use if time allows<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>2 options<\/td>\n<td>~50%<\/td>\n<td>Usually worth attempting \u2014 probability tilts strongly in your favor<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>3 options (only one left)<\/td>\n<td>~100%<\/td>\n<td>Answer confidently<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<\/tbody>\n<\/table><\/div>\n<p>Note: The exact math behind expected-value decisions can be written down if you like, but in the exam the practical heuristic above keeps decisions fast and sound.<\/p>\n<h2>Section-wise Micro-Strategy<\/h2>\n<h3>Physics<\/h3>\n<p>Physics rewards clarity of concepts and clean numerical steps. In the paper, prioritize problems that are direct applications of a well-understood formula and that lead to numerical answers quickly. Problems that involve long, multi-branch reasoning or heavy diagram interpretation should be assessed for time cost before investing.<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Scan for problems that match standard templates (motion, circuit, optics patterns).<\/li>\n<li>Use approximations carefully \u2014 only when they are safe and commonly accepted.<\/li>\n<li>Write intermediate units and signs to reduce silly errors.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3>Chemistry<\/h3>\n<p>Chemistry is often the quickest source of solid marks when you know the facts and reaction patterns. Split your approach: Physical chemistry and stoichiometry are calculation-driven; organic chemistry rewards reaction recognition; inorganic chemistry is memory-based.<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Answer all memory-based inorganic questions quickly if you are confident.<\/li>\n<li>For organic, sketch the mechanism or intermediates briefly if it helps \u2014 often that will confirm the correct product.<\/li>\n<li>Don\u2019t over-complicate calculation-based problems; short, correct steps beat long, error-prone work.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3>Mathematics<\/h3>\n<p>Mathematics is the time sink and the biggest opportunity. Prioritize problems where the path to the solution is immediately visible: coordinate geometry with direct formula application, standard integration\/differentiation tasks, and algebraic manipulations that simplify quickly. Avoid problems that require long casework unless you have plenty of time and high confidence.<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Take advantage of quick wins: substitution, symmetry, or known identities.<\/li>\n<li>If a math problem will take more than 8\u201310 minutes without clear progress, mark and return.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2>Practical Example: A Realistic Time Allocation Plan<\/h2>\n<p>Below is a sample breakdown that many high scorers adapt to their strengths. Tailor the ratios based on whether you are stronger in one or two subjects.<\/p>\n<div class=\"table-responsive\"><table>\n<thead>\n<tr>\n<th>Phase<\/th>\n<th>Time (minutes)<\/th>\n<th>Primary Goal<\/th>\n<th>Actions<\/th>\n<\/tr>\n<\/thead>\n<tbody>\n<tr>\n<td>Pass 1<\/td>\n<td>0\u201340<\/td>\n<td>Score quick, sure marks<\/td>\n<td>Answer all sub-2-minute questions; flag anything you changed<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Pass 2<\/td>\n<td>40\u2013130<\/td>\n<td>Solve medium difficulty<\/td>\n<td>Target questions you can solve in 3\u20138 minutes; avoid deep-casework<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Pass 3<\/td>\n<td>130\u2013170<\/td>\n<td>Attempt tougher, high-return problems<\/td>\n<td>Select 2\u20134 difficult problems you\u2019re prepared for; spend focused time<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Review<\/td>\n<td>170\u2013180<\/td>\n<td>Final verification<\/td>\n<td>Check flagged answers, numeric entries, and question slips<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<\/tbody>\n<\/table><\/div>\n<h2>Mock Tests and Post-Mock Analysis<\/h2>\n<p>Mimic the exam closely: three-hour duration, no interruptions, the same rough work behavior. But mocks are only productive when you analyze them properly. Every mock has two value streams: the score trend and the error taxonomy. Pay equal attention to both.<\/p>\n<h3>What to Log After Each Mock<\/h3>\n<ul>\n<li>Questions you got wrong and why (categorize by concept, careless error, or time issue).<\/li>\n<li>Questions you left blank and why (no idea, time ran out, foolish block).<\/li>\n<li>Questions you guessed and whether your elimination logic was sound.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3>Adjust the Practice Plan<\/h3>\n<p>If you repeatedly miss a sub-topic, create a short targeted practice block (10\u201315 problems) that you repeat until you stop making the mistake. If time management is the issue, shorten your per-question time caps in the next mock so you build speed discipline.<\/p>\n<h2>Common Traps and How to Avoid Them<\/h2>\n<ul>\n<li>Over-long fixation: If you can\u2019t make steady progress in 5\u20138 minutes, move on and come back later.<\/li>\n<li>Second-guess syndrome: Frequent answer changes usually signal doubt; only change answers when you find a clear error in your earlier reasoning.<\/li>\n<li>Careless arithmetic: Use small checks \u2014 units, limiting-case checks for physics, and dimension sanity checks for math.<\/li>\n<li>Misreading the question: Underline or mentally note key phrases like \u201cnot,\u201d \u201cexcept,\u201d or specific constraints.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><img src='https:\/\/asset.sparkl.me\/pb\/blogs-image\/img\/98042cb6d4784bf4b145783c8c8ec8c1.jpg' alt='Photo Idea : A strategy board with color-coded time blocks and sticky notes labeled Physics, Chemistry, Mathematics'><\/p>\n<h2>How Personalized Guidance Can Fit In<\/h2>\n<p>High-percentile attempts benefit from tailored feedback loops. A calm arrival reduces stress and keeps focus sharp.<\/li>\n<li>Eat a steady, familiar breakfast and avoid heavy or unfamiliar foods that could sap energy.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3>During the Exam<\/h3>\n<ul>\n<li>Breathe rhythmically if you feel anxiety rising; a quick breathing break resets cognitive control.<\/li>\n<li>Stick to your plan: follow the three-pass approach and use time caps you rehearsed in mocks.<\/li>\n<li>Use the facility\u2019s rough paper clearly; write legibly so review is fast and reliable.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2>Sample Mini Walk-Through<\/h2>\n<p>Imagine you open the paper and see a mix of short-certainty chemistry questions, predictable physics numerical problems, and a few long mathematics questions. In Pass 1 you pick 25\u201330 short chemistry and physics items you can answer in one minute each \u2014 fifteen minutes of clean marks. Pass 2 you spend on confident math topics and moderate physics problems; you collect another wave of secure marks. In Pass 3 you pick two math questions that you can finish in 12\u201315 minutes each and revisit any flagged chemistry memory items. The final minutes are for one careful review and to lock in your answers.<\/p>\n<h2>Putting It All Together \u2014 Weekly Practice Template<\/h2>\n<p>Balance is key: one or two full-length mocks per week with focused topical practice every day. Keep a weekly rhythm: two intensive topic sessions (60\u201390 minutes each), daily short problem bursts (30\u201345 minutes), and one longer mock with deep analysis. Over time, this pattern improves accuracy, timing, and your decision-making muscle.<\/p>\n<h2>Final Checklist Before You Submit Your Answers<\/h2>\n<ul>\n<li>Ensure you have answered all high-confidence questions first and not left obvious gains on the table.<\/li>\n<li>Double-check numeric entries and make sure no digits are transposed.<\/li>\n<li>Confirm that you didn\u2019t change an answer impulsively late in the exam.<\/li>\n<li>Use the last minutes to scan flagged questions for any trivial oversights.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2>Conclusion: The Academic Route to a 99 Percentile<\/h2>\n<p>Consistent application of a disciplined three-pass approach, smart time allocation, practiced elimination strategies, and rigorous post-mock analysis will shift your percentiles upward. Prioritize accuracy, protect your time, and refine your decision rules \u2014 those academic habits form the clearest path to the 99 percentile.<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Proven, exam-focused strategies to attempt JEE Main like a high-percentile performer \u2014 time management, three-pass method, smart guessing, section tactics and mock-analysis tips.<\/p>\n","protected":false},"author":3,"featured_media":0,"comment_status":"open","ping_status":"open","sticky":false,"template":"","format":"standard","meta":{"footnotes":""},"categories":[331],"tags":[13268,10030,13266,13047,11907,13053,13267,12995],"class_list":["post-20675","post","type-post","status-publish","format-standard","hentry","category-jee","tag-accuracy-over-attempts","tag-exam-day-plan","tag-jee-99-percentile","tag-jee-main-strategy","tag-mock-test-strategy","tag-negative-marking-jee","tag-physics-chemistry-mathematics-tactics","tag-time-management-for-jee"],"yoast_head":"<!-- This site is optimized with the Yoast SEO plugin v26.1.1 -
